Interval Data Envelopment Analysis (Interval DEA) which is the approach that could make efficiency measurement with interval or fuzzy input and output data of Data Envelopment Analysis (DEA) which is used to measure the relative efficiencies of Decision-Making Units (DMU) in multi-input and multi-output processes was examined in this study. This model which was based on arithmetic operations with interval numbers, provides, unlike other DEA models, the relative efficiency measurements of DMU with inputs and outputs which had interval data, by using fixed and combined production limit without the need of extra variable or scale transformation. Interval efficiency of 21 commercial banks in Turkish banking sector in 2011 was calculated to show how related method was implemented in this study.Downloads
